Vi. Orbukh et Oa. Manaev, 2ND-ORDER DISPLACIVE PHASE-TRANSITION IN FERROELECTRIC SOLID-SOLUTIONS, Physica status solidi. b, Basic research, 179(1), 1993, pp. 207-213
The method of the average field is employed to study the second-order
displacive phase transition in ferroelectric solid solutions. Computat
ion of the free energy of the solid solution is made for ferroelectric
and paraelectric phases. Temperature dependences of the spontaneous p
olarization, concentration dependences of the phase transition tempera
ture, Curie constant, and dielectric susceptibility as well as the con
dition for the existence of the phase transition in mixed crystals are
obtained.
